• DISTINGUISHING FEATURES OF THE CLASS:

Adjunct faculty teach department courses on a part-time basis and evaluate student performance pursuant to guidelines set by the department and the College. Adjunct faculty report to the Department Chair for their discipline. Adjunct faculty are responsible for preparing lesson plans, teaching aids, and instructional materials or activities for class. Adjunct faculty must maintain accurate records on students and submit pertinent data to the department and/or the College.

M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S:
• Bachelor's Degree
• 3 years of relevant work experience or relevant certification
• Ability to supervise student work
• Demonstrated technical competence in 1 or more of the subject areas offered: program languages, networking (design, configuration, hardware & infrastructure), hardware & software, AI, Cybersecurity, relational databases (design, development & management), project management.

PREFERRED QUALIDFICATIONS:
• Teaching experience at the high school or college level.
• Master's degree
